True. The Twenty-Negro Law was a Confederate law passed during the American Civil War that exempted an owner or overseer of twenty or more slaves from military service.

This exemption favored wealthy plantation owners, who were able to hire poor whites to serve in their place or to hire slaves to work the land. The law was controversial, as it allowed wealthy planters to avoid military service and potentially increased resentment among poor whites, who were forced to fight in the war.

The Treaty of Echota was signed on December 29, 1835, between the United States government and a minority faction of the Cherokee Nation. The treaty was controversial because it was signed without the consent of the majority of the Cherokee people, and it resulted in the forced removal of thousands of Cherokee from their ancestral lands in the southeastern United States to Indian Territory (present-day Oklahoma) in what became known as the Trail of Tears.

Under the terms of the Treaty of Echota, the Cherokee people ceded all their lands east of the Mississippi River to the United States government in exchange for compensation of $5 million and land in Indian Territory. The treaty also provided for the establishment of a Cherokee Nation government in Indian Territory and guaranteed the Cherokee people the right to self-government and protection of their property rights.

However, many Cherokee leaders, including Principal Chief John Ross, opposed the treaty and argued that it was not valid because it was signed without the consent of the majority of the Cherokee people. The U.S. government disregarded these objections and used the treaty to justify the forced removal of the Cherokee people from their homes in the southeastern United States to Indian Territory.

All three terms and names represent key battles that had strategic importance and had a significant impact on the outcome of World War II. The terms and names in each group - Stalingrad, D-Day, and the Battle of the Bulge - have the commonality of being significant battles during World War II.


1. Stalingrad: This was a major battle fought between German and Soviet forces in 1942-1943. It was a turning point in the war as the Soviet Union successfully defended the city, marking a major defeat for the German army.
2. D-Day: This refers to the Allied invasion of Normandy, France on June 6, 1944. It was the largest amphibious invasion in history and marked a crucial turning point in the war. The successful invasion allowed the Allies to establish a foothold in Europe and ultimately led to the liberation of Western Europe from Nazi control.
3. Battle of the Bulge: This battle took place from December 16, 1944, to January 25, 1945, in the Ardennes region of Belgium, France, and Luxembourg. It was the last major German offensive on the Western Front during the war. Despite initial successes, the German advance was eventually halted by the Allied forces, and it marked a significant setback for the Germans.

The gentlemen's agreement was a deal in which the Japanese agreed to limit emigration of workers to the United States as long as the federal government agreed not to prohibit Japanese immigration.

An unofficial agreement known as the Gentlemen's Agreement of 1907–1908 was made between the United States and Japan to reduce rising tensions between the two nations, notably those involving immigration. In exchange for Japan agreeing to deny emigration passports to Japanese laborers while still allowing wives, children, and parents of current immigrants to enter the United States, it demanded that U.S. President Theodore Roosevelt compel San Francisco to revoke its order desegregating Japanese-American schools.

Many male Japanese immigrants got married off-contract to so-called "picture brides," in order to get around the agreement. A man might bring his new wife into Japan legally if he wed a Japanese citizen. While being a picture bride—so named because prospective husbands chose them based on their photographs—gave some women the chance to start fresh lives in America, it may also carry risk because the women didn't know their future spouses or the state of their future homes.

Up to 1924, more than 10,000 Japanese women joined the country, with more than 15,000 moving to Hawaii. Approximately 1% of California's population at the time was made up of immigrants from Japan.

The postwar consensus was not as real as many had believed it to be. While there was certainly a general agreement among Americans on certain key issues.

Such as the need for economic growth and the importance of individual freedoms, there were also deep divisions that had been simmering beneath the surface for some time.

These divisions were brought to the forefront in 1968, a year that saw a series of dramatic and traumatic events, including the assassination of Martin Luther King Jr. and Robert Kennedy, protests and riots in cities across the country, and a bitter and divisive presidential campaign.

The seismic breakdown in social harmony is complex and multifaceted. One factor was the rapid social and cultural changes that had taken place in the postwar period, including the civil rights movement, the rise of the counterculture, and the Vietnam War. These changes challenged long-held beliefs and values, and many Americans found themselves struggling to adapt to a rapidly changing world.

1. Civil rights movements: The postwar consensus had not addressed racial inequalities adequately, and the civil rights movements of the 1950s and 1960s challenged this consensus. As activists fought for equal rights, clashes between protestors and authorities revealed the deep-rooted racial tensions in American society.

2. Anti-war sentiment: The Vietnam War, which escalated in the 1960s, caused a growing divide between the government and the public. The war's negative impact on the economy, the loss of American lives, and its controversial nature led to widespread disillusionment and anti-war protests, further eroding the postwar consensus.

3. Economic inequalities: The postwar consensus was based on a belief in shared prosperity, but economic disparities became more evident in the 1960s. Poverty and unemployment persisted, especially among minority populations, while wealth accumulated in the hands of a few. This fueled social unrest and contributed to the breakdown of the consensus.

The Articles of Confederation and Perpetual Union was an agreement among the 13 original states of the United States of America that served as its first constitution. It was approved, after much debate (between July 1776 and November 1777), by the Second Continental Congress on November 15, 1777, and sent to the states for ratification. The Articles of Confederation came into force on March 1, 1781, after being ratified by all 13 states. A guiding principle of the Articles was to preserve the independence and sovereignty of the states. The weak central government established by the Articles received only those powers which the former colonies had recognized as belonging to king and parliament.
